Data in “Typ” column is at 5V, 25C unless otherwise stated. These parameters are for design guidance only and are not
tested.
These parameters are for design guidance only and are not tested, nor characterized.
Note 1:
Instruction cycle period (TCY) equals four times the input oscillator time-base period. All specied values are based on
characterization data for that particular oscillator type under standard operating conditions with the device executing code.
Exceeding these specied limits may result in unstable oscillator operation and/or higher than expected current consump-
tion. All devices are tested to operate at “min.” values with an external clock applied to the OSC1 pin.
When an external clock input is used, the “Max.” cycle time limit is “DC” (no clock) for all devices.
